2009 audi s5 review this car review is specific to this model, not the actual vehicle for sale. Great coupes that drive as good as they look. introductionthe audi a5 and the high-performance s5 are mid-size coupes, larger than the tt. A handsome, distinctive shape identifies the a5 and s5 models from virtually any angle, with flowing curves bringing musculature to sleek, aerodynamic forms and arresting light patterns. They seat two-plus-two; the rear seats are for the occasional adult passengers or for bringing small kids along. The a5 involves the driver physically, audibly, and mentally though never to the point of making it a chore or less than inviting. While the $40,700 a5 and $51,400 s5 may be judged on paper against the infiniti g37, clk350, or bmw 335i coupe, the amenities, cabin finish and room are such that the audis may also be shopped against the jaguar xk, bmw 650i, or porsche 911. And while each is a fine car and may offer more speed or perhaps technological gadgetry, only the 911 matches the audi with the availability of all-wheel drive, and for a $6,000 premium. the a5 and s5 were launched as 2008 models and have been on the market for only a short time, so there are no significant changes for 2009. lineupthe audi a5 41,700) features a 265-hp v6 engine, six-speed manual gearbox and quattro all-wheel drive. The 2008 audi s5 51,400) uses a 354-hp v8 engine. Both versions are available with a six-speed automatic transmission 1,300). the a5 comes with leather upholstery, including the steering wheel and shifter, and wood trim. Another option is the s line package 2,900), with firmer suspension, 19-inch wheels, different trim in and out, sport seats, aluminum trim, and a multi-function, leather-wrapped steering wheel. The s5 manual transmission model carries the mandated u. Gas guzzler tax 1,300). safety gear that comes standard on all a5 and s5 models consists of two-stage driver and adaptive passenger frontal airbags, front side-impact airbags, side curtain airbags, backguard headrests, electronic stability control, abs, ebd, all-wheel drive, and tire pressure monitors. walkaroundaudi a5 and s5 are arguably among the better looking cars on the road, appearing at once formal and sporting. On each side a strong character line arches over the front wheel and carries all the way to the tail, but apart from the bottom of the door and sides of the panoramic glass roof there's hardly a straight line to be found. proportions are classic coupe with minimal bodywork ahead of the front wheels, a substantial rear roof pillar, moderate trunk lid and a longer tail than snout. The door windows are frameless and visual strength is added by a central pillar that hides as a dark panel behind the rear side glass. out in the open the a5 appears larger than it really is; almost the same length as a bmw 3 series coupe or a mercedes clk, which is narrower; the audi is half a foot shorter than jaguar's xk, bmw's 650 or bentley's gtc and just half a foot longer than a 911, yet it comes across at least as spacious inside as any of those. in terms of styling, the a5 is the cleanest, the s5 the most aggressive, and the a5 with s-line package splits the difference. The leading edges of the car are the inner points of the lower grilles that separate the central grille section from the lights and side grilles, much like the leading points of a manta ray. Every surface has a pleasant feel, regardless of the material from which it's constructed. the s5 cabin is done in mostly dark materials, including the woven headliner and sunshade. Lighter trim highlights the roof panel pull (it slides forward from the rear), gauge nacelles, vents, speaker grilles, and control knobs with piano black centers. The black lacquer also surrounds the primary control area aft of the shifter. a three-spoke leather-wrapped wheel has hand grips at all the right places and just two controls on each side spoke. However, each side has a thumbwheel that serves multiple functions by scrolling up or down or pressing to click, allowing a majority of system operations to be done without removing a hand from the wheel. Oft-used controls like cruise, signals, flash-to-pass/main beams, and wipe/wash are all on handy stalks. the wheel adjusts for reach and rake with a single manual release, giving all the advantages, proper driving position, spacing from airbag, instrument view; the only downside is that the wheel position does not adjust automatically with the seat/mirror memory system on cars so equipped. On the s5 the headrests are integral with the backrest and not adjustable, yet the head rest and neck protection are all in the right place and satisfactory for those well past six feet. Thigh extensions in the seat cushions let those tall drivers use more chair than just the area under their pants pockets, and there's plenty of leg room and a good dead pedal. a fast-slide switch on the front seat backrests eases access to the rear buckets which are nicely sculpted and comfortable for most up to 5-feet, 10-inches tall.
